Improve Home Energy Efficiency
Leaky ducts can waste up to 30% of your conditioned air, boosting your monthly energy bills. A professional airflow balance testing pinpoints where energy escapes. By fixing these issues, you improve your home’s HVAC performance and enjoy lower utility bills all year long.

Typical Duct Inspection Costs
Standard ventilation checks in Calgary typically range from between $150 and $300, depending on number of vents. This cost often includes duct leak detection, offering critical insights into your indoor air quality.

Why Quotes Vary Across Calgary
Multiple factors can impact the final price of a HVAC system check in Calgary. Multi-level properties require complex navigation, while hard-to-reach ducts may trigger extra charges. Services bundled with air filter replacement will also elevate the total.

How Do Technicians Check Ductwork in a Calgary Home?
A licensed HVAC technician typically begins with a visual assessment and then uses a high-resolution video duct camera to navigate inside your system, detecting leaks, blockages, or damage. This method allows for accurate duct leak detection and a complete furnace duct inspection without invasive wall removal. The process also includes an airflow balance testing and duct insulation check to assess efficiency and identify areas where duct sealing services could help.
